Content & Trigger Warnings for Gone With the Wind (1936)
13 content warnings identified for this book.
Quick Summary
Yes, Gone With the Wind (1936) contains 13 content warnings : Racial slurs / racism (depicted), Religious persecution, Death of a child, Grief / bereavement (major focus), Miscarriage / pregnancy loss / stillbirth, Gaslighting / emotional manipulation, Infidelity, War / combat, Alcohol abuse (depicted), Domestic violence / intimate partner abuse, Gore / graphic violence, Sexual assault / rape, Slavery / forced labor.
The most severe warnings are for Racial slurs / racism (depicted) (severity 5/5), Death of a child (severity 4/5), Grief / bereavement (major focus) (severity 4/5), Infidelity (severity 4/5), War / combat (severity 5/5), Slavery / forced labor (severity 5/5).

| Warning | Severity |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| Identity & Discrimination | |||
| Racial slurs / racism (depicted) | 5/5 | Depicted | Slavery and racial oppression central to the story |
| Religious persecution | 1/5 | Referenced | Brief references to religious and cultural prejudices in the antebellum South |
| Mental Health & Emotional | |||
| Death of a child | 4/5 | Depicted | Death of Bonnie Blue and Scarlett's child |
| Grief / bereavement (major focus) | 4/5 | Depicted | Multiple character deaths lead to extended depictions of grief and loss throughout the novel |
| Miscarriage / pregnancy loss / stillbirth | 3/5 | Depicted | Miscarriage depicted |
| Other | |||
| Gaslighting / emotional manipulation | 3/5 | Depicted | Emotional manipulation in relationships |
| Infidelity | 4/5 | Depicted | Multiple affairs and love triangles |
| War / combat | 5/5 | Depicted | Civil War battles depicted extensively |
| Substance Use | |||
| Alcohol abuse (depicted) | 3/5 | Depicted | Rhett Butler's and others' heavy drinking |
| Violence & Physical Harm | |||
| Domestic violence / intimate partner abuse | 3/5 | Depicted | Abusive treatment of enslaved people and marital conflict |
| Gore / graphic violence | 3/5 | Depicted | War injuries and death described |
| Sexual assault / rape | 3/5 | Referenced | Sexual exploitation of enslaved women implied |
| Slavery / forced labor | 5/5 | Depicted | Slavery is a central element of the story set during the Civil War-era American South, with enslaved characters throughout |
